diff --git a/before.json b/before.json new file mode 100644 index 0000000..0eb7c25 --- /dev/null +++ b/before.json @@ -0,0 +1 @@ +{"PatchOpsPerSec":0,"Add10MBTime":0.23459157020000002,"Add10MBStdev":0.03707814523620726,"DirAddOpsPerSec":0,"DirAddOpsStdev":0,"Cat1MBTime":15.3019408,"Cat1MBStdev":3.9775222434949495,"MkGraphTime":0,"TravGraphTime":0,"TravGraphStdev":0} diff --git a/ipfs-whatever b/ipfs-whatever new file mode 100755 index 0000000..f6a7180 Binary files /dev/null and b/ipfs-whatever differ diff --git a/main.go b/main.go index abdc150..2c7efad 100644 --- a/main.go +++ b/main.go @@ -151,9 +151,9 @@ func checkTraverseGraph() (float64, float64, float64, error) { base := "QmUNLLsPACCz1vLxQVkXqqLX5R1X345qqfHbsf67hvA3Nn" cur := base log.Println("generating graph...") - width := 10 + width := 2 bmkgraph := time.Now() - for i := 0; i < 300; i++ { + for i := 0; i < 50; i++ { next := base for j := 0; j < width; j++ { n, err := sh.PatchLink(next, fmt.Sprint(j), cur, false) @@ -169,7 +169,7 @@ func checkTraverseGraph() (float64, float64, float64, error) { mkpath := func() string { out := new(bytes.Buffer) - for i := 0; i < 290; i++ { + for i := 0; i < 40; i++ { fmt.Fprintf(out, "/%d", rand.Intn(width)) } return cur + out.String()